Transaction a148511442ccbfa4403957e9dcefbe7dd662324243726efa24c0b888c0a1b2fc
1 Input
1 Output
-
a148511442ccbfa4403957e9dcefbe7dd662324243726efa24c0b888c0a1b2fc:0
- value
- 89882395
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bab087f226f7dfb7c9216db2652464b5ca57d9e2 OP_EQUAL
- address
- 3Ji95pGeAmAaQcaFrXP62rHMM4MCE7BU7U